India A had announced its squad for the three match series against South Africa A, which were the unofficial ODIs. And after a long time, Ruturaj Gaikwad made his way back to the team in this format. He was a part of the team in the unofficial Tests, but watching him back in the 50-over format was a great moment
And Gaikwad ensured that he utilised this opportunity to a great extent. He was given the opening slot, and was sent to open for the team with Abhishek Sharma. In the first match, India was given a target of 286 runs, where Gaikwad showed that he is working hard to make his comeback
Gaikwad went on to score 117 runs off 129 balls in the game, which helped India A to win the match. He was also given the Player of the Match award for India A in this game. With this win, the team entered the second game of the series, and this time the bowlers were able to put up a dominant show South Africa A batsmen.
India A was able to bowl out South Africa A for just 132 runs. In the chase, the team went on to win the game by 9 wickets, also winning the series with one game to go. Ruturaj Gaikwad also ended up scoring 68 runs off 83 balls in this chase, scoring more than half runs alone.
Shreyas Iyer suffered a serious injury in the India tour of Australia. During the second ODI, Iyer attempted to take a catch while running backwards but he fell in an awkward position. Eventually, he hit hard on his chest and injured his spleen, which led to internal bleeding. He spent a few days in the ICU at the Sydney Hospital
Taking a look at his injury, it is clear to the fans that he may not be able to make it to the series against South Africa. In his place, India will be needing someone who could bat for the team at number four and even score runs. With Gaikwad showcasing his worth to the team in the List A games, it could finally help him to get a spot in the Indian team after his last ODI game in 2023.
